ORLY's technical profile is largely bullish. The stock is trading above its 50-day SMA (88.47) and its 20-day EMA (87.93), indicating short-to-medium term upward momentum. The RSI at 63.5, classified as 'BULLISH', further supports this positive trend, suggesting strong buying interest without being overextended. The MACD at 0.31 also points towards positive momentum.
While the price is currently below its 200-day SMA (93.26), suggesting potential resistance at that level, the confluence of other positive indicators points to a generally constructive chart pattern. The CCI at 124.04 indicates strong buying pressure. Key support levels will be the 50-day SMA and the 20-day EMA, while the 200-day SMA presents a near-term resistance hurdle.

O'Reilly Automotive's P/E ratio of 28.49 is elevated compared to the sector average of 22.5, suggesting a premium valuation. However, its reported revenue growth of 10.2% significantly outpaces the sector average of 8.5%, which may justify the higher multiple. The EPS of $3.18 indicates profitability, and the company's market cap of $75.55 billion reflects its substantial scale within the auto parts industry.
The company's ability to sustain such growth in a mature industry is a key fundamental strength. While valuation metrics appear stretched on a P/E basis, the robust revenue expansion suggests that investors are pricing in continued strong performance. Further analysis of profit margins and balance sheet health would be beneficial to fully assess its fundamental standing relative to its valuation.
